According to a recent LinkedIn post from Tenable, the cybersecurity company is drawing attention to findings from its Tenable Cloud and AI Security Risk Report 2026. The post indicates that 70% of surveyed organizations have integrated at least one AI or Model Context Protocol third-party code package, pointing to a rapid pace of AI adoption.

The post highlights a widening gap between this adoption and corresponding security oversight, and suggests that CISOs and security leaders should focus on securing AI integration through comprehensive visibility and identity-centric controls. For investors, this emphasis may signal Tenable’s intent to position its offerings more deeply around AI and cloud security risk, potentially expanding its addressable market and reinforcing its role within enterprise security budgets.
